How many points will be deducted for occupying the lane when overtaking?

1 Answers
StJanelle
07/30/25 1:35am
Occupying the lane when overtaking does not result in point deduction but incurs a fine. Below are precautions for overtaking: Observe traffic conditions: Before overtaking, observe the road conditions ahead and try to choose a flat and straight road. Check the situation of the lane to be borrowed, and observe from the left rearview mirror whether there is a vehicle behind attempting to overtake. Before overtaking, turn on the left turn signal and honk the horn to indicate your intention. At night, continuously switch the headlights to signal. If there is a vehicle behind attempting to overtake, wait until it completes the overtaking maneuver before proceeding with your own. Light usage: When conditions for overtaking are met, turn on the left turn signal, then alternately switch between high and low beams while honking the horn to alert the vehicle ahead. Once you confirm that the vehicle ahead has signaled to yield, you can steer to the left. Driving in the borrowed lane: If already in the borrowed lane, downshift and press the accelerator deeply to increase engine RPM and enhance power. The reason for downshifting is that when accelerating, downshifting and pressing the accelerator provide a quicker response, enabling faster acceleration.

How to Replace the Battery in a BMW 1 Series Key?

Method for replacing the battery in a BMW 1 Series key: 1. Press the switch on the back of the key to remove the mechanical key; 2. Insert the removed mechanical key into the small hole on the side of the key to open the key cover; 3. After prying open the key cover, the old battery inside will be visible; 4. Use a small flat-head screwdriver to remove the depleted battery; 5. Ensure the new battery is placed with the positive side facing up; 6. Reassemble the key in reverse order; 7. Test the key functions to ensure they are working properly. The BMW 1 Series key has three buttons: lock, trunk open, and unlock. Holding down the unlock button can simultaneously lower all four windows, while holding down the lock button can simultaneously raise all four windows.

How to Use the Cruise Control on the New Sagitar?

Usage method of cruise control on the new Sagitar: 1. Press the power button to turn on the system, and the cruise control indicator light on the dashboard will illuminate; 2. Accelerate to the desired speed, press the SET button while lifting your right foot off the accelerator to set the speed at the current rate; 3. Press the RES button to restore the previous cruise control speed. The Sagitar is a joint-venture A+ class sedan brand under FAW-Volkswagen, with its predecessor being the fifth-generation Jetta sedan under Volkswagen AG, positioned as a German high-performance sedan. In 2006, Volkswagen AG introduced the fifth-generation Jetta compact sedan to the Chinese market and renamed it Sagitar.

How to Check the Oil Dipstick on a Volkswagen?

Method for checking the oil dipstick on a Volkswagen: 1. Park the car on a level surface and open the front hood; 2. Remove the oil dipstick and wipe off the oil marks with a clean cloth; 3. Reinsert the dipstick all the way back into the engine, wait a few seconds, then pull it out again; 4. Observe the portion of the dipstick wetted by oil to accurately measure the oil level. The oil dipstick is usually located next to the engine. When you open the front hood, you'll notice a yellow pull ring on the left side of the engine - that's the oil dipstick. It is a commonly used measuring tool to determine the static oil level height, indicating whether the engine oil volume is within the appropriate range.

What does Toyota KDSS mean?

Toyota KDSS stands for Kinetic Dynamic Suspension System, which is an electronically controlled dynamic suspension system. Its main functions are to enhance off-road driving capability and stability, as well as improve comfort and handling during highway driving. What happens if you don't engage the parking brake when parking an automatic transmission car?

Not engaging the parking brake when parking an automatic transmission car can damage the vehicle's transmission, affecting subsequent driving and gear shifting. For automatic transmission models parked on uneven surfaces, it's recommended to first engage the parking brake before shifting to P (Park) mode to protect the transmission. The P mode is the parking gear - when the vehicle is in P position, the parking lock mechanism locks the transmission output shaft, preventing rotation of gears inside the transmission. For prolonged parking on slopes, first use the parking brake, then place bricks or similar objects against the front wheels facing downhill to transfer the load to the wheels before reapplying the parking brake.
